With 2 percent of Illinois’ corn crop in the ground as of this last weekend, folks are wondering how fast things will progress. A Champaign, IL, based company has some great information available that could help make the projections. That company, Agrible, was started by a group of ag engineers who started with a seed of an idea to give farmers a range of new tools by harnessing the power of big data. As the idea grew, so did their team. They are now ag engineers, farmers, data scientists, engineers, agronomists, atmospheric scientists, programmers, and designers. Their expertise covers a range of disciplines, but their mission is the same - to make precise data easily available, so farmers across the globe can increase their productivity and yields. In a partnership with IL Corn, Agrible is bringing special opportunities to you as a members of the Illinois Corn Growers Association. One of their free services that may interest you is their weekly weather report video. 

The weekly video is released each Monday and covers Illinois and nationwide weather considerations. You can find the week’s video at https://www.morningfarmreport.com/weeklyweather or by clicking on the image below.

Agrible's latest weekly video suggests that dryer and warmer weather is on its way for Illinois, just in time to boost that planting progress number up from 2 percent and into the range of the 5-year average.
